Introduction to the M5 Motorway
The M5 motorway is a crucial part of the UK’s road network, serving as a major route for traffic between the Midlands and the South West of England. Connecting cities like Birmingham, Bristol, and Exeter, the M5 not only facilitates commercial transportation but is also essential for daily commuters. Recent developments and upgrades along the motorway highlight its significance and the government’s commitment to improving infrastructure.
